Vintage 8mm home movie footage from 1977 captures a nighttime hula dance performance on a stage in Honolulu, Oahu, Hawaii. Dancers in traditional grass skirts and colorful attire perform under dramatic blue and white stage lighting, with palm trees silhouetted against the dark sky. The grainy, low-light film quality and soft focus create an authentic retro atmosphere, showcasing a classic Hawaiian cultural event. The audience is visible in the foreground, watching the graceful, rhythmic movements of the performers.
